📖 About Siena Province
Siena province captures the essence of rural Tuscany, with its rolling hills, vineyards, and medieval towns. The historic city of Siena anchors the province, while iconic destinations like Montepulciano, Pienza, and Montalcino define the landscape.
The climate is warm and dry in summer, with cooler winters compared to coastal Tuscany. Seasonal variation is more noticeable here, particularly in higher elevations.
Daily life is slower and deeply rooted in tradition. Local markets, vineyards, and community events shape everyday routines. The province appeals strongly to expats seeking a peaceful lifestyle surrounded by natural beauty.
Siena connects easily to Florence and Grosseto, making it a central base within Tuscany.
